Solve each equation.
1. 9/2x+18+3x=11/2
2. (x+6)-(2x=7)-3x=-9

Respuesta :

luana
luana luana
  • 19-09-2014
[tex]1.\\\frac{9}{2}x+18+3x=\frac{11}{2}\ \ \ \ \ |Multiply\ by\ 2\\\\ 9x+36+6x=11\\\\ 15x+36=11\ \ \ |Subtract\ 36\\\\ 15x=-25\ \ \ |Divide\ by\ 15\\\\ x=-1\frac{2}{5}\\\\ 2.\\ (x+6)-(2x-7)-3x=-9\\\\ x+6-2x+7-3x=-9\\\\ -4x+13=-9\ \ \ |Subtract\ 13\\\\ -4x=-22\ \ \ |Divide\ by\ -4\\\\ x=5,5[/tex]
